import { GQtyError } from 'gqty'; import * as React from 'react'; import { translateFetchPolicy } from '../common.mjs'; function UseLazyQueryReducer(state, action) { switch (action.type) { case "loading": { if (state.isLoading) return state; return { data: state.data, isLoading: true, isCalled: true, promise: action.promise }; } case "success": { return { data: action.data, isLoading: false, isCalled: true }; } case "failure": { return { data: state.data, isLoading: false, error: action.error, isCalled: true }; } case "cache-found": { return { data: action.data, isLoading: state.isLoading, isCalled: true }; } } } function InitUseLazyQueryReducer() { return { data: void 0, isLoading: false, isCalled: false }; } function createUseLazyQuery({ resolve }, { defaults: { retry: defaultRetry, lazyQuerySuspense: defaultSuspense, lazyFetchPolicy: defaultFetchPolicy } }) { const useLazyQuery = (fn, { onCompleted, onError, fetchPolicy: hookDefaultFetchPolicy = defaultFetchPolicy, retry = defaultRetry, suspense = defaultSuspense, operationName: defaultOperationName } = {}) => { const [state, dispatch] = React.useReducer( UseLazyQueryReducer, void 0, InitUseLazyQueryReducer ); if (suspense) { if (state.promise) throw state.promise; if (state.error) throw state.error; } return React.useMemo(() => { const fetchQuery = async ({ fn: resolveFn = fn, args, fetchPolicy = hookDefaultFetchPolicy, operationName = defaultOperationName } = {}) => { let innerFetchPromise; try { const fetchPromise = resolve( ({ query }) => resolveFn(query, args), { awaitsFetch: false, cachePolicy: translateFetchPolicy(fetchPolicy), onFetch(promise) { innerFetchPromise = promise; }, retryPolicy: retry, operationName } ).then((data2) => { const typedData = data2; if (fetchPolicy === "cache-and-network") { dispatch({ type: "cache-found", data: typedData }); } return innerFetchPromise != null ? innerFetchPromise : typedData; }); dispatch({ type: "loading", promise: fetchPromise }); const data = await fetchPromise; onCompleted == null ? void 0 : onCompleted(data); dispatch({ type: "success", data }); return data; } catch (error) { const typedError = GQtyError.create(error); onError == null ? void 0 : onError(typedError); dispatch({ type: "failure", error: typedError }); throw error; } }; return Object.freeze([fetchQuery, state]); }, [fn, onCompleted, onError, retry]); }; return useLazyQuery; } export { createUseLazyQuery };
